Understanding the Basic Anatomy of the Torso
To effectively learn how to draw anime torso, you must first understand the basic anatomy involved. The torso consists of several key components that contribute to its overall structure.
The Main Parts of the Torso
- Chest: The chest, or thorax, is the upper portion that houses vital organs. It is wider at the top and tapers downwards.
- Abdomen: The abdomen is located below the chest and contains the stomach and other organs. It typically narrows towards the waist.
- Waist: The waist marks the transition between the abdomen and the pelvis. It is crucial for establishing posture and movement.
Proportions of the Torso
When considering proportions while learning how to draw anime torso, it’s important to remember that an average adult human torso is about 3 to 4 heads in length. In anime, artists often exaggerate proportions for creative expression, so feel free to adjust these guidelines based on your style.
Steps to Draw an Anime Torso
Now that you understand the anatomy, let’s dive into specific steps on how to draw anime torso effectively.
Step 1: Sketch Basic Shapes
To begin, sketch simple geometric shapes that represent the torso's structure. Start with an oval for the chest and a smaller oval or rectangle for the abdomen.
Step 2: Define the Outline
Using your basic shapes as a guide, define the outline of the torso. Pay attention to how the curves of the chest flow into the abdomen. Use light strokes to allow for adjustments.
Tips for Outlining
- Use curved lines for a more organic look.
- Indicate the ribcage with slight indentations.
- Ensure the shoulders are proportionate to the torso.
Step 3: Add Details
Once the outline is complete, add details such as muscles, collarbones, and any clothing that your character may be wearing. This step brings your drawing to life.
Features to Consider
- Muscle Definition: In more athletic characters, show muscle tone by adding subtle lines along the chest and abdomen.
- Clothing: For anime styles, consider how clothing fits over the torso. Use flowy lines for loose clothes and tighter lines for fitted attire.
Practicing Different Poses
Learning to draw different poses is crucial in mastering how to draw anime torso. Different angles can dramatically change how the torso appears, affecting the overall composition.
Static vs. Dynamic Poses
Static poses maintain a neutral body position, making it easier to focus on proportions. Dynamic poses showcase action and movement, which requires understanding how the torso shifts under different circumstances.
Examples of Poses
- Standing Pose: Emphasize the natural shift in weight. The torso leans slightly to one side.
- Sitting Pose: Show compression in the upper body and adjust the torso shape to fit the seat.
- Action Pose: Utilize strong lines to depict motion and tension, illustrating how the torso twists and bends.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
While learning how to draw anime torso, beginners often make common mistakes that can hinder their development.
Rushing Proportions
One major error is neglecting correct proportions. Always take time to measure and compare components before finalizing your sketch.
Ignoring Anatomy
Artists sometimes overlook anatomical structures, leading to unnatural representations. Continuously study reference images to enhance your skills.
